小程序悬浮(小程序悬浮窗怎么设置)
小程序悬浮窗设置及使用方法,让你的小程序更加便捷
小程序悬浮窗是一种在手机屏幕上浮动显示的小程序入口,可以在其他应用程序运行时快速打开小程序,提供更加便捷的用户体验,在小程序开发中,设置悬浮窗可以增加小程序的曝光度,方便用户随时访问,提高用户粘性,本文将详细介绍小程序悬浮窗的设置方法及使用技巧。
小程序悬浮窗的设置方法
1. 在小程序的app.json文件中,添加window对象,并设置navigationBarTitleText属性为小程序的标题。
示例代码:
```
"window": {
"navigationBarTitleText": "我的小程序"
}
2. 在小程序的app.json文件中,添加requiredBackgroundModes属性,并设置为["floating"],表示小程序需要在悬浮窗模式下运行。
"requiredBackgroundModes": ["floating"]
3. 在小程序的页面文件中,添加onShow方法,并在该方法中调用wx.createShortcut方法创建悬浮窗。
onShow: function() {
wx.createShortcut({
success: function(res) {
console.log(res);
},
fail: function(err) {
console.log(err);
}
})
4. 在小程序的页面文件中,添加onHide方法,并在该方法中调用wx.destroyShortcut方法销毁悬浮窗。
onHide: function() {
wx.destroyShortcut({
小程序悬浮窗的使用技巧
1. 悬浮窗的位置调整:可以通过调用wx.updateShortcut方法,传入x和y参数来设置悬浮窗的位置,示例代码:wx.updateShortcut({x: 100, y: 200})
2. 悬浮窗的点击事件:可以通过监听悬浮窗的点击事件,实现自定义的跳转逻辑,示例代码:wx.onShortcutClick(function(res) {console.log(res)})
3. 悬浮窗的样式定制:可以通过在app.json文件中的window对象中添加backgroundColor属性,设置悬浮窗的背景颜色,示例代码:"window": { "backgroundColor": "#ff0000" }
4. 悬浮窗的显示控制:可以通过调用wx.hideShortcut和wx.showShortcut方法来控制悬浮窗的显示和隐藏,示例代码:wx.hideShortcut()、wx.showShortcut()
总结
通过以上的设置方法和使用技巧,你可以轻松地为你的小程序添加悬浮窗功能,提供更加便捷的用户体验,悬浮窗可以增加小程序的曝光度,方便用户随时访问,提高用户粘性,希望本文对你有所帮助,祝你的小程序开发顺利!
还没有评论,来说两句吧...